Kwara NUJ/Attahiru Ibrahim Inter-Chapel Table Tennis tournament final holds tomorrow

Jide Allen of Radio Kwara and Bolakale Alabi of NTA are through to the final of the Kwara NUJ/ Attahiru Ibrahim table tennis tournament, in the male category.
In the female category, Janet Bogunjoko of the Herald Newspaper will play the defending champion, Bamidele Yetunde of the State Information in the final.
The Inter-Chapel competition is holding at the NUJ Press Centre, Offa road, Ilorin.
To reach the final, Jide Allen edged out Ibrahim Ahmed of National Pilot in two straight sets in the first semi-final, while Bolakale Alabi defeated Baba Ibrahim of National Orientation Agency (NOA) also by two straight sets.
Both Ibrahim Ahmed of National Pilot and Baba Ibrahim of NOA are joint third winners in the male category, while Itunu Olaosebikan of Radio Kwara and Nusirat Popoola of Kwara Television are joint third winners in the female category.
Eight female and 10 male players from the affiliated Chapels of the NUJ are taking part in the competition.
While declaring the competition open, the Chairman of the Kwara State Council of  NUJ, Mallam Abdullateef ‘Lanre Ahmed commended the sponsor of the tournament who is the Special Adviser on Sports Matters to Kwara Governor, Mallam Attahiru Ibrahim, noting that his gesture has achieved the purpose of strengthen and promoting unity among journalists in the state.
Mallam Ahmed, who thanked Chapel leaders for mobilizing their members for the competition said that the essence of the tournament is to ensure sense of unity and spirit of sportsmanship among members of the pen pushing profession, adding that the Council would ensure it’s sustained.
